Amends Idaho Code Section 36-104 to authorize the Fish and Game Commission to issue controlled hunt permits for bear and turkey in addition to deer, elk, and antelope.
-
Allows landowners of property valuable for habitat or propagation purposes of bear or turkey to receive additional controlled hunt permits and collect fees under rules prescribed by the commission.
-
Amends Idaho Code Section 36-106 to add bear and turkey to the list of wildlife that may be subject to special depredation hunts to protect property from damage.
-
Authorizes the director to declare open seasons for bear and turkey depredation hunts and make orders specifying when, where, by what means, and in what amounts the wildlife may be taken.
-
Requires the director to provide up to 50% of available depredation permits to private landowners within the hunt area before issuing remaining permits to the general public.
Legislative Description
Amends existing law to provide that certain controlled hunt permits may also be issued for bear and turkey; and to provide that wildlife subject to special depredation hunts shall include bear and turkey.
